How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hancock County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hancock County Studio Apartments | $526 | $481 | $680 |
| Hancock County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,335 | $479 | $1,788 |
| Hancock County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,622 | $780 | $2,220 |
| Hancock County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,993 | $1,469 | $3,796 |
| Hancock County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,100 | $2,100 | $2,100 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Hancock County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Hancock County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Hancock County is $1,415.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Hancock County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Hancock County is a 1,200 square feet unit starting from $1,180 at Washington Village Apartments.
What is the average size for Hancock County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Hancock County is currently at 731 sq ft.
